Brilliant but Heartbreaking

This was such a great watch! I honestly regret not watching it when it first came out, but that’s adult life, I guess! 😂

Anyway, the storyline, character development, plot, and acting were all amazing. You definitely have to give it a chance, though—the first episode starts off quite confusing, but trust me, it gets SO good!

I loved all the characters. I mean, I came for Trin and Tawan, but my heart was completely stolen by Nara and the Colonel! And honestly, even the villains were incredibly well done.

I also loved the film music and, oh my god, the costumes! The clothes they chose for each character were unbelievably good-looking and fit the characters so well. The whole visual style of the series was just beautiful.

There were, however, a few things I didn’t like. I feel like Nara and the Colonel were done dirty, and I’m still not over it. 😭 But at the same time, the wife as the true villain was phenomenal. I was crying and completely in awe at the same time!

One other thing that bothered me was the amount of smoking. For some reason, literally everyone seemed to be a smoker! 😂 I know the story takes place in the 60s and that smoking was very common back then, but the sheer amount of cigarettes felt like a bit too much.

All in all, this was a really great watch! Brilliant, emotional, beautifully acted, and absolutely heartbreaking. Definitely a series I’m glad I finally watched!

Nice leads, a bit too long

Istumbled upon this drama and ended up really enjoying it, so I kept watching. However, one thing that bothered me was that at some point it felt too long without much real development.
For example, the Storm Alliance arc could have been handled better. I think they should have focused more on Ning Fei and the Doctor Lady during that part, letting them deal with their storyline, while the others handled separate plots. Also, the Xia guy became quite irrelevant after leaving Sucha, which felt like a missed opportunity—he could have had more development when he returned.
At the beginning, I really disliked the sister with her puppy-love behavior and honestly wanted her gone. But later on, I actually loved her dynamic with Emperor Xia. Their weird, toxic relationship was strangely cute to watch, and his death felt really cruel.
Overall, it’s a decent watch. I did skip a few scenes here and there, but the lead actors did a great job.

Wholesome

This was cute but boring.
I love the manga, and I know that in a series adaptation it will never be the same, which is why this was cute and nicely paced, but still a bit boring.
I did like the OST. What I was missing, though, was more animal interaction. I mean, Shizuma is a vet, and the brother is supposed to own a rabbit shop, so they should have included that more in the series.
If you want to watch something wholesome, then this is the series for you.
The characters were likable, and the atmosphere was calm and relaxing, but the story sometimes felt a bit too slow, and not much really happened. I was hoping for a bit more emotional depth and character development.

The MC was good

I had zero expectations when I started watching this because I had no idea what it was about. So I was very pleasantly surprised.

The main characters were great, they had a good storyline, and I really enjoyed the mystery surrounding the murder and the occult aspects of the story — and all of that in a BL! The story itself felt like a masterpiece. At times, I even had to pause and remind myself that this was a BL because the storytelling was just that good.

And contrary to popular opinion, I enjoyed the last three episodes just as much. The reveal of the murderer and the resolution of the whole case were very well done. Again, considering that this is a BL, it was fantastic.

The only thing I didn’t really like was the second couple, the two doctors. I didn’t find either of them particularly likable, and I also felt that they didn’t add much to the police case.

Overall, this drama felt like a genuinely well-crafted story, and I really hope to see more BL series like this in the future.

it was fine.....

Overall, it was an okay watch. I especially liked the storyline with the murder mystery and the group of college students. The plot had a few twists and turns that were handled quite well, which kept things interesting.

However, in my opinion, the actor who played Kamin was a bit weak. I also didn’t really like the way the story was edited. They often showed the murder first and then switched to a soft, romantic scene with the characters who later discover the body. I think it would have worked better the other way around to build more suspense.

This is just my personal opinion, but I also think the story would have benefited from a second couple. They could even have focused more on the college students, which might have made the story feel more balanced.

The main leads felt a bit too boring to carry so much of the focus, mainly because they didn’t really have a strong storyline of their own. Their scenes sometimes felt like they belonged to a completely different narrative, and then the show would suddenly switch back to the actual plot.

All in all, it was still an okay watch with an interesting concept, but it had some weaknesses in the execution.
